Assam: Waterlogging on National Highway-37 Dibrugarh; traffic movement disrupted

DIBRUGARH:  Due to heavy rain lashed with thunderstorm, the National Highway-37 in Dibrugarh was waterlogged.

Overnight rain waterlogged the streets, causing problems for the local residents as well as the students to pass through the road. “Cars as well heavy vehicles going towards Guwahati face immense problem due to severe waterlogging on NH-37,” said a resident.

Due to unchecked encroachment near the Dibrugarh Town Protection (DTP) drain, the flood water from the town cannot flow easily to the drain, which causes severe waterlogging in some areas Dibrugarh. Similarly, the road near Hotel Garden Treat, which has now become an important link road towards Thana Chariali, has deteriorated due to waterlogging. Due to the dismantling the overbridge, the vehicles passing through the road have to face problems due to the flash flood like situation.

On the other hand, big trees which were uprooted fell on the Dibrugarh AMCH road causing disruption of traffic movement. “Every year due to waterlogging, we face a lot of problem because of poor drainage system. The department concerned construct roads in every ward but fails to construct the drains. Due to faulty construction of roads and unscientific drain construction, waterlogging has become a big problem in Dibrugarh,” alleged a local resident. In the Banipur area, flash flood-like situation occurred due to the heavy spell of rain.
